If App Portal fails to insert a device, it should set the InsertDate in the WD_PackageRequests table to the current time, plus 1 hour.. It will continue this process indefinitely until the insert is successful. Even if you were to restart the service, I'd not expect that the insert would take place until the 1 hour has elapsed.. Is the service stopping? Are there a large number of failures occurring at the same time? I'd start by looking at collectionInsert_<server>.log.. If you see an insert count in excess of 100, then you may be running into a scenario where the collection insert is blocking due to a large number of failures. I do seem to remember an issue in older versions where multiple inserts might be running at the same time due to this backlog.. Let me know if you are seeing a large number of failures in the above mentioned log file.. There are a couple of things we can do.. The best being cleaning up the failures..

@CharlesW The error wasnt a failed insert. The error was "Dataset returned from <SCCM Server> was invalid....Server was unable to process request. Object not set to an instance of an object..." -- This error occurred on 2/19 at 6pm and no collection inserts were attempted until this morning when i restarted the service. All orders until the restart had a pending status without any machine policy messages.

For those that may run into this issue -- the issue was actually caused by removing the email from site alerts in the admin panel. This was causing the ESD service to stop. The information for that ESD service stoppage is referenced and resolved in this KB article.
